Hôte inconnu exception de l'AWS client Java?
Quelqu'un d'autre a couru à travers cette exception? Nous l'avons vu lors d'un test de charge, la nuit dernière. Le nom d'hôte est correct et fonctionne normalement très bien. Il a juste commencé à lancer cette exception la nuit dernière. Soit c'était un hasard DNS échouer sur amanzon ou le SDK Aws pour Java fait quelque chose d'inattendu sous la charge.
> Caused by: java.net.UnknownHostException: sdb.amazonaws.com
at java.net.Inet6AddressImpl.lookupAllHostAddr(Native Method)
at java.net.InetAddress$1.lookupAllHostAddr(InetAddress.java:867)
at java.net.InetAddress.getAddressFromNameService(InetAddress.java:1246)
at java.net.InetAddress.getAllByName0(InetAddress.java:1197)
at java.net.InetAddress.getAllByName(InetAddress.java:1128)
at java.net.InetAddress.getAllByName(InetAddress.java:1064)
at org.apache.http.impl.conn.DefaultClientConnectionOperator.resolveHostname(DefaultClientConnectionOperator.java:242)
at org.apache.http.impl.conn.DefaultClientConnectionOperator.openConnection(DefaultClientConnectionOperator.java:130)
at org.apache.http.impl.conn.AbstractPoolEntry.open(AbstractPoolEntry.java:149)
at org.apache.http.impl.conn.AbstractPooledConnAdapter.open(AbstractPooledConnAdapter.java:121)
at org.apache.http.impl.client.DefaultRequestDirector.tryConnect(DefaultRequestDirector.java:561)
at org.apache.http.impl.client.DefaultRequestDirector.execute(DefaultRequestDirector.java:415)
at org.apache.http.impl.client.AbstractHttpClient.execute(AbstractHttpClient.java:820)
at org.apache.http.impl.client.AbstractHttpClient.execute(AbstractHttpClient.java:754)
at org.apache.http.impl.client.AbstractHttpClient.execute(AbstractHttpClient.java:732)
at com.amazonaws.http.AmazonHttpClient.executeHelper(AmazonHttpClient.java:266)
Avez-vous un leader ou un suiveur de l'espace dans le nom d'hôte chaîne de caractères dans le code?
Nope cette url est interne à l'AWS SDK Java, Viens de découvrir Aws NOUS-Orient, c'était d'avoir des problèmes de connectivité réseau de la nuit dernière. C'est probablement la cause de
avez-vous jamais résoudre ce problème?
Il s'en alla sur elle-même après un certain temps.
Nope cette url est interne à l'AWS SDK Java, Viens de découvrir Aws NOUS-Orient, c'était d'avoir des problèmes de connectivité réseau de la nuit dernière. C'est probablement la cause de
avez-vous jamais résoudre ce problème?
Il s'en alla sur elle-même après un certain temps.
OriginalL'auteur Usman Ismail | 2012-03-15
Vous devez vous connecter pour publier un commentaire.
Modifier /etc/hosts de la manière suivante:
vieux
127.0.0.1 localhost localhost.localdomain
nouveau
127.0.0.1 localhost localhost.localdomain ajouter-votre-localhost-nom-ici
Pourquoi voudriez-vous faire cela?
OriginalL'auteur Bilgin Ibryam
J'ai été confrontée au même problème
Caused by: java.net.UnknownHostException: ec2.sa-east-1.amazonaws.com
tout en faisantlein palette
de télécharger des fichiers à aws seau/ou tout en essayant d'obtenir les adresses ip des machines distantes.1. Essayez d'abord,
Projet de nettoyage, Attente de quelques minutes/heures et puis refiring
lein pallet up -P aws-ec2
avec la même aws configuration a fonctionné pour moi.2. Deuxième essai,
Exécuter
lein pallet up -P aws-ec2
pour uniquegroups
au lieu de l'ensemble du cluster.OriginalL'auteur prayagupd